Klasöre ve alt klasöre nasıl tam izin verebilirim


24

Ubuntu'da yeniyim ve yeni bir klasör oluşturmalı /varve makinedeki tüm kullanıcıların bu klasöre tam izin vermesi gerekiyor.

Nasıl ilerlemeliyim?


Ubuntu'ya Sormaya Hoş Geldiniz! ;-)/var Tüm kullanıcılar için tam izne sahip bir klasör oluşturmak istiyor musunuz ??? Zaten bir tane var! ve denir tmp!
Fabby

Cevabınız için teşekkürler, evet yapmak istiyorum ama lütfen ne demek istediğinizi zaten var! ve buna tmp denir!
Sam

1
/ tmp, RAM belleği kullanan geçici bir dosya sistemine sahip bir sistem dizinidir. Oraya konan her şey yeniden başlatıldığında silinecek.
Eduardo Cola

@EduardoCola: aslında disk kullanıyor, ancak evet, yeniden başlatıldığında silindi! ( quiet splashÖnyükleme parametrelerinden kaldırdığınızda bunun olduğunu görebilirsiniz ...) ;-)
Fabby

/ Tmp, tmpfs ile kullanılmaz mı? Hangi RAM kullanır?
Eduardo Cola

Yanıtlar:


25

Bir terminale gitmek için Ctrl+ Alt+ tuşlarına basın Tve şunu yazın:

sudo mkdir /var/szDirectoryName
sudo chmod a+rwx /var/szDirectoryName

szDirectoryNameİstediğiniz dizinin adı nerede , a"tümü" (kullanıcılar) +"aşağıdaki hakları ekle" rwxanlamına gelir ve read, write ve e anlamına gelir.x sırasıyla ecute ...

Not: Zaten böyle bir dizin var içinde /var: tüm kullanıcılar erişebilir hangi tmp(tam yol: /var/tmp) kendisi sembolik olarak almaktadır /tmp.
Ancak tüm dosyaların /tmpönyükleme sırasında silindiğini unutmayın.

Daha fazla bilgi için, işte Linux'taki tüm dizinler için harika bir kaynak.


peki emrinizi yerine getirdikten sonra ls -l / var / nameoffolder yazarken toplam 0 aldığım anlamına gelir mi?
Sam

Bu komutu biliyorum ls .. bu klasörde ne olduğunu listelemek için kullanılır ama -l bana izinler sağlayın?
Sam

Asıl sorunuz cevaplandı. Başka sorunuz varsa, bir tane daha sorun ! Lütfen bu sitenin nasıl yürüdüğünü daha iyi anlamak için Ubuntu'yu Sor Turunu ziyaret edin , çünkü forumdan oldukça farklıdır ... Ortalama bir süre zarfında click tıklanması faydalı olacaktır ... ;-)
Fabby

üzgünüm, cevabınızı sormak istediğim ifadeyle düzenlemiştiniz, zaten / var içinde tüm kullanıcıların erişebileceği bir dizin var: / tmp ile işaretlenmiş tmp bu, / var içinde oluşturulacağım klasörlerin silineceği anlamına geliyor in / tmp
Sam

17

Terminali aç

Şunlarla Dizin Oluştur mkdir:

sudo mkdir /var/DirectoryName

Bir klasöre tüm izinleri vermek için chmod -R 777:

sudo chmod -R 777 /var/DirectoryName
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.